Herts Police are appealing for information after a nine-year-old went missing in London.

Saraya, from Hemel Hempstead, was last seen in Beckton Road, Canning Town, at around 9pm on May 22 after being reported missing to police on May 3.

She is described as being of average build and having medium length curly hair. Police added that she has a piercing on her upper lip and is usually seen wearing colourful leggings.

The girl is not believed to be alone, and is likely to be in the company of her mother, but a Herts Police spokesperson said that officers are growing “increasingly concerned about Saraya’s welfare”.

She has links to the Canning Town area of London as well as Hemel Hempstead.

Anyone who thinks they are with the nine-year-old or have seen her recently have been asked to call 999 immediately and quote ISR 522 of 3 May.

Anyone who has seen Saraya since she was reported missing, or has information about where she has been, is asked to report it online or by calling 101 quoting the same reference number.
